Struct deno_lockfile::JsrPackageInfo
source · pub struct JsrPackageInfo {
pub dependencies: BTreeSet<String>,
}
Fields§
§dependencies: BTreeSet<String>
List of package requirements found in the dependency.
This is used to tell when a package can be removed from the lockfile.
Trait Implementations§
source§impl Clone for JsrPackageInfo
impl Clone for JsrPackageInfo
source§fn clone(&self) -> JsrPackageInfo
fn clone(&self) -> JsrPackageInfo
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for JsrPackageInfo
impl Debug for JsrPackageInfo
source§impl Default for JsrPackageInfo
impl Default for JsrPackageInfo
source§fn default() -> JsrPackageInfo
fn default() -> JsrPackageInfo
Returns the “default value” for a type. Read more
source§impl<'de> Deserialize<'de> for JsrPackageInfo
impl<'de> Deserialize<'de> for JsrPackageInfo
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l Hash for JsrPackageInfo
impl Hash for JsrPackageInfo
Auto Trait Implementations§
impl RefUnwindSafe for JsrPackageInfo
impl Send for JsrPackageInfo
impl Sync for JsrPackageInfo
impl Unpin for JsrPackageInfo
impl UnwindSafe for JsrPackageInfo
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more